Choosing the Right System: 5 Critical Factors

Not all solar lighting solutions are created equal. Consider these specifications:

  1. Lumen output vs coverage area requirements
  2. Battery cycle life (aim for 2,000+ cycles)
  3. IP67 waterproof rating minimum
  4. Warranty coverage (industry average: 3 years)
  5. Local climate adaptability

FAQ: Solar Lighting Essentials

  • Q: How long do solar lights last at night?A: Modern systems provide 8-12 hours illumination with 1-2 days backup
  • Q: Can they withstand extreme weather?A> Yes, when specified with marine-grade aluminum housing
